The Effects of Activation Energy and Thermophoretic Diffusion of Nanoparticles on Steady Micropolar Fluid along with Brownian Motion
The present study is related to the effects of activation energy and thermophoretic diffusion on steady micropolar fluid along with Brownian motion.
